Scope and Contents
Includes the paper by Selig and Alison S. Brooks, "We have Met Our Ancestor and He is Us: Teaching Archaeology Through Robert Humphrey's AnthroNotes Cartoons." Text of the joint paper is included, along with the overhead projection images used. Selig and Brooks' February 2, 2006, Department of Anthropology Colloquium titled: "We Have Met our Ancestor and He is Us: Examining the Origins of Modern Humans through the Science of Art and the Art of Science," is shown in the Department Colloquium flyer included along with the texts for the two talks.
